The Field Manager is responsible for helping their sites achieve safety and contractual performance obligations for our customers. This position will assist with keeping our sites safely operating at optimum with troubleshooting, campaigns, initiatives, quality & maintenance checks, and OJT training of technicians.

The Field Managers shall know all aspects of safety in the above-mentioned activities. In this position you shall have knowledge and experience with Lock Out Tag Out, generating asset functionality, maintenance, and troubleshooting renewable energy generating assets.


Responsibilities:

As the Field Manager your responsibilities include:

Ø Oversee technician hiring, time off approval, timecard approval, and career development.

Ø Identify & close Tech training and skill needs - cross training weaknesses with stronger techs, when possible, to build core strengths.

Ø Train and mentor developing technicians in electrical safety and proper maintenance of equipment.

Ø Support technicians and assist with project management at site


Ø Front line communication service to customers

Ø Interface and communicate effectively with site leaders, teams and customers.

Ø Assist customer with annual budgeting for improvements, repairs, campaigns

Ø Attend customers monthly / weekly performance calls

Ø Provide monthly plant summaries to performance engineering for reporting

Ø Schedule & plan work to minimize customer losses and/or ensure team safety

Ø Assist with customer budgeting and estimates for resolution of site issues, improvements, and campaigns

Ø Develop Succession Planning for site technician teams

Ø Oversee work schedules to ensure technician recovery time and within overtime allowances.

Ø Manage CMMS Work Order reviews for record accuracy and billing when out of scope.

Ø Utilize CMMS to track work, inspections, and schedules

Ø Work with Leadership to identify business inefficiencies, processes, and gaps that can be improved on.

Ø Lead by example. Be the standard and example of excellence Tech’s can strive to achieve.

Ø Lead and or assist with troubleshooting, diagnosis, for root cause remedy & repair of offline turbines to return to service

Ø Identify turbine performance issues and develop plans to remedy ideally during scheduled maintenance.

Ø Ensure all equipment is operating as designed with only customer / engineering approved solutions, software, hardware, and wiring.

Ø Perform quality checks of work performed to ensure technicians and contractors are performing quality work.

Ø Assist other contractors when needed to coordinate wind turbine large correctives.

Ø Be a safety advocate and utilize stop work when needed

Ø Work with customers to schedule and coordinate equipment outages

Ø Maintain a strong safety mindset and support the EHS culture

Ø Follow all NERC, NFPA70E, company & customer policies and other applicable regulations

Ø Document all service activity and parts consumptions using digital reporting systems.


Ø And all other duties as assigned.
